Breath of the Wild features several different Bows for long-distance combat. Many of these Bows follow a series of archetypes, such as "Boko," "Soldier's," and "Traveler's." Initially, Link can carry up to five Bows at a time in his inventory; however, he can obtain additional slots by giving Korok Seeds to Hestu. Hestu will upgrade Link's slots up to 13 slots. If Link takes another Bow while his inventory is full, he will drop the Bow or put it back if it came from a Treasure Chest. Each Bow, including duplicates, occupies its own slot in the inventory. The other seven slots are occupied by all six types of Arrows and the Bow of Light. Some Bows also have bonus abilities such as shooting Arrows at quicker succession or multiple Arrows at once.

List of Bows

Bow Strength Durability Range Description

Ancient Bow
44 120 40 This bow is the result of Robbie's research. Ancient Sheikah technology allows it heightened functionality, Arrows fired from it travel in a perfectly straight line.

Boko Bow
4 16 20 A basic Bokoblin bow made of wood. It's made by taking any tree branch and tying a string to either end, so don't expect much in the way of combat effectiveness.

Bow of Light
100 100 500 Princess Zelda gave you this bow and arrow for the battle with Dark beast Ganon. When wielded by the hero, it fires arrows of pure light strong enough to oppose the Calamity.

Dragon Bone Boko Bow
24 30 20 A Boko bow reinforced by fossils. Bokoblins handpicked the materials it's made from, so it boasts a respectable firepower.

Duplex Bow
14×2 18 40 A bow favored by the skilled archers of the Yiga Clan. It's been engineered to fire two arrows at once to ensure your target comes to a swift and none-too-pleasant halt.

Falcon Bow
20 50 40 A highly refined Rito-made bow created by a master Rito craftsman. Rito warriors favor it for its superior rate of fire, which helps them excel even further at aerial combat.

Forest Dweller's Bow
15×3 35 20 The Koroks made this bow for Hylians. It's crafted from flexible wood and uses sturdy vines for the bowstring. Its construction may be simple, but it fires multiple arrows at once.

Golden Bow
14 60 20 This Gerudo-made bow is popular for the fine ornamentations along its limbs. Designed for hunting and warfare alike, this bow was engineered to strike distant targets.

Great Eagle Bow
28×3 60 40 A bow without equal wielded by the Rito Champion, Revali. it's said Revali could loose arrows with the speed of a gale, making him supreme in aerial combat.

Knight's Bow
26 48 20 The sturdy metal construction of this bow offers superior durability, while its lack of firing quirks makes it quite reliable. Once favored by the knights at Hyrule Castle.

Lizal Bow
14 25 20 A wooden bow created by Lizalfos. It's reinforced by the bones of a large fish - a marked improvement over any standard wooden bow.

Lynel Bow
10×3 30 20 A Lynel-made bow crafted from rough metal. True to the vicious nature of Lynel weaponry. It fires a spread of multiple arrows at once. Ideal for taking down quick-moving targets.

Mighty Lynel Bow
20×3 35 20 This massive Lynel bow sports a bowstring made from a metal so tough, mere Hylians have trouble drawing it back.

Phrenic Bow
10 45 40 A bow passed down through the Sheikah tribe. Concentrating before drawing the string will allow you to target distant enemies as easily as those nearby.

Reinforced Lizal Bow
25 35 20 A Lizal bow with a grip reinforced by metal. The body is made from the branches of a flexible tree that grows near water, which offers some serious destructive power.

Royal Bow
38 60 20 In the past, the king of Hyrule presented this bow to only the most talented archers in the land. Its combat capabilities are as impressive as its extravagant design.

Royal Guard's Bow
50 20 30 This prototype Sheikah-made bow was designed to fight the Great Calamity. made with anient technology, it boasts a high rate of fire and firepower but has low durability.

Savage Lynel Bow
32×3 45 20 This Lynel bow is made from a special steel found at the peak of Death Mountain. It has tremendous stopping power and can pierce thick armor as easily as thin paper.

Silver Bow
15 40 20 A bow favored by the Zora for fishing. It doesn't boast the highest firepower, but the special metal it's crafted from prioritizes durability.

Soldier's Bow
14 36 20 A bow designed for armed conflict. Inflicts more damage than a civilian bow, but it will still burn if it touches fire.

Spiked Boko Bow
12 20 20 An upgraded Boko Bow bound with animal bone to boost its durability and firepower. Its craftsmanship is sloppy, but it's light and easy to use.

Steel Lizal Bow
36 50 20 This bow is wielded by lizalfos who are expert marksmen. The metal that reinforces much of the weapon adds some additional weight but offers heightened durability.

Swallow Bow
9 30 40 This bow is a favorite among Rito warriors. The bowstring has been specially engineered for aerial combat, which allows it to be drawn faster than a normal bow.

Traveler's Bow
5 22 20 A small bow used by travelers for protection. It doesn't do a lot of damage, but it can be used to attack foes from a distance.

Twilight Bow
30 100 8,000 A bow used by the princess who fought the beasts of twilight alongside the hero. It's said to contain the spirits of light's power. It fires arrows straight and true, as if beams of light.

Wooden Bow
4 20 20 This wooden bow may not be the most reliable for battling monsters, but it is excellent for hunting small animals.
